Household of Nicolas Joseph BRONCHART

(1) He is married to Marie Madeleine Louise DELHAYE.

They got married on April 10, 1788 at Wannebecq, 7861, Hainaut, Belgique, , he was 28 years old.Source 2


(2) He is married to Marie Catherine VANGUTTE.

They got married about 1798.
